High Precision Outer Rotor Torque Motor
This outer rotor torque motor features high precision and stable operation, optimized for direct drive systems in industrial robotics and semiconductor equipment. With strong torque capacity and excellent thermal management, it ensures long-term performance in demanding environments.

Frame Outer Rotor Torque Motor HANS-C Series Specification | |||||
Motor Model No.:HANS-C-xxx-Dxxx-Hxxx-Txx-1-A | C-003 | C-007 | C-015 | ||
Performance Parameters | Symbol | Unit | |||
Cable Outlet | 1 | 1 | 1 | ||
Outer Diameter | D1 | mm | 170 | 170 | 170 |
Center Hole | D2 | mm | 45 | 45 | 45 |
Installation Height | H | mm | 95 | 112 | 132 |
Continuous torque (Tmax) | Tc | Nm | 3 | 9 | 17 |
Peak torque | Tp | Nm | 9.0 | 27.7 | 51.0 |
Vmax,Tc@Vbus=310Vdc | Nmax,Tc | Rpm | 600 | 600 | 450 |
Vmax,Tp@Vbus=310Vdc | Nmax,Tp | Rpm | 500 | 500 | 350 |
Vmax,0@Vbus=310Vdc | Nmax,0 | Rpm | 800 | 800 | 500 |
Encoder (BISS-C) | P/rev | 23bits | 23bits | 23bits | |
Positioning Accuracy | arc sec | ±10/±5 | ±10/±5 | ±10/±5 | |
Repeat Accuracy | arc sec | ±1.5 | ±1.5 | ±1.5 | |
Maximum axial load (recommend) | Fa | N | 700 | 700 | 700 |
Maximum torque load (recommend) | T | Nm | 40 | 40 | 40 |
Motor outlet | M | 0.3 | 0.3 | 0.3 | |
Cable bending radius (within drag chain) | mm | 37.5 | 37.5 | 37.5 | |
Continuous current (Tmax) | Ic | Arms | 2.5 | 2.3 | 2.5 |
Peak Current (1s) | Ip | Arms | 7.5 | 6.9 | 7.5 |
Torque Constant (within 25℃±5℃) | Tf | Nm/Arms | 1.2 | 4.0 | 6.8 |
Electromotive constant (within 25℃±5℃) | Te | Vrms/rad/s | 0.4 | 1.3 | 2.3 |
Resistance (within 25℃±5℃) | R | Ω(p-p) | 2.6 | 4.8 | 6.6 |
Inductance (within 25℃±5℃) | L | mH(p-p) | 6.0 | 12.5 | 19.0 |
Pole pairs | p | 8 | 8 | 8 | |
Max.coil temperature | Tmax | ℃ | 120 | 120 | 120 |
Motor Mass | KG | 8.4 | 14.5 | 16.5 | |
Mover Mass | Mc | KG | 2 | 4 | 6 |
Rotor Moment of Inertia | Jm | Kg*m2 | 0.012 | 0.021 | 0.027 |
Axial Runout | mm | 0.03 | 0.03 | 0.03 | |
Radial Runout | mm | 0.03 | 0.03 | 0.03 |

Characteristics:
1. Direct-drive rotary DDR torque motors combine with several design features to deliver their intended function.
2. Torque motors using coreless technology, which are designed to drive loads directly without the need of any transmission mechanism, such as gears or belts.
3. They use high energy permanent magnets to generate high torque.
4. High rigidity, high precision, high speed, high acceleration and small noise etc.
